The Food Network site has always been a bit of a disappointment to me. Sure you can find the latest recipes from Emeril, but there has always been something lacking to me. Or perhaps, I was overly distracted by all of the attempts at ecommerce - ads and links everywhere to shopping pages on the Food Network site itself.

Things are getting better however. With the launch of Iron Chef America the Food Network has finally started to get into the whole interactive TV / Web thing. There is a game that allows you to play along with show, in real time which I found to be a real enhancement to the overall experience of watching. When you add good background information (bios on chefs and challengers, movies on food shopping for the show, etc), it looks like the marketing brains at Food Network finally are beginning to get it.
